Transaction 958131598149c794e68bd0ed392eb940d4e0bd7b454fd71e57eaeec7d616c536

1 Input
2 Outputs
  • 958131598149c794e68bd0ed392eb940d4e0bd7b454fd71e57eaeec7d616c536:0
  • value  747063
    address  112mA4AXGgpqrQvf5xi3jW9cj57QZx7efp
  • 958131598149c794e68bd0ed392eb940d4e0bd7b454fd71e57eaeec7d616c536:1
  • value  730205
    address  1N3mFMXWZxor7DyQh7gGJtuUPQjUZioohx